BACKGROUND: The use of quantitative PCR (qPCR) for detection of Bordetella bronchiseptica in bronchoalveolar lavage fluid (BALF) and demonstration of bacteria adhering to ciliated epithelial cells in BALF or bronchial brushing fluid (BBF) has not been assessed in a series of affected dogs. Coinfections can worsen the clinical severity in bordetellosis, but the specific association with Mycoplasma cynos has not been evaluated. OBJECTIVES: To assess the utility of culture, qPCR and cytologic examination of cytospin preparations in the diagnosis of bordetellosis in dogs and the influence of coinfection by M. cynos on disease severity. ANIMALS: Twenty-four referred dogs with B. bronchiseptica infection and 10 healthy dogs. METHODS: Retrospective case series. qPCR (B. bronchiseptica and M. cynos) and culture results from BALF were recorded. Cytospin preparations from BALF and BBF were reviewed. qPCR on BALF from 10 healthy dogs were used as negative control. RESULTS: The BALF culture and qPCR detected B. bronchiseptica in 14/24 and 18/18 dogs, respectively. Coccobacilli were found adhering to ciliated epithelial cells in 20 of the 21 BALF cytologic preparations where epithelial cells were found, and 2/3 BBF cytologic preparations. Quantitative PCR detected a low level of B. bronchiseptica in one healthy dog. The frequency of detection of M. cynos was not significantly different in B. bronchiseptica (9/17 dogs) compared with healthy dogs (2/10 dogs) (P = .09). CONCLUSION AND CLINICAL IMPORTANCE: Quantitative PCR detection of B. bronchiseptica in BALF appears to be a useful diagnostic tool. Cytologic examination of BALF or BBF, when positive, allows a rapid and reliable diagnosis.

Administration of omeprazole by ventriculo-cisternal perfusion or intravenously has been shown to decrease cerebrospinal fluid (CSF) production in dogs and rabbits. Oral omeprazole has consequently been recommended to reduce CSF production in dogs with conditions in which clinical signs may be attributable to an accumulation of CSF in the central nervous system (e.g. hydrocephalus, syringomyelia). The albumin quotient (QAlb), the ratio between CSF and serum albumin concentration, has been proposed as a reliable means to evaluate CSF production; decreasing CSF production should cause an increase in QAlb. The aims of this study were to assess the effect of oral administration of omeprazole on QAlb in dogs and to compare two methods to assess CSF albumin concentration. Fifteen healthy Beagle dogs received omeprazole (1.2 mg/kg/day) orally for 14 days; CSF and blood were obtained before and after treatment. CSF albumin concentrations were evaluated by nephelometry and high-resolution protein electrophoresis. Regardless of the method used for measuring albumin, QAlb did not change significantly following oral omeprazole administration, suggesting that CSF production in healthy dogs may not be affected by chronic oral therapy with omeprazole.

Thirty-eight endurance horses underwent clinical and ancillary examinations, including haematological and biochemical evaluation, standardised exercise tests both on a treadmill and in the field, Doppler echocardiography, impulse oscillometry, video endoscopy and collection of respiratory fluids. All of the examined poorly performing horses were affected by subclinical diseases, and most of them had multiple concomitant disorders. On the contrary, the well-performing horses were free of any subclinical disease. The most frequently diagnosed diseases were respiratory disorders, followed by musculoskeletal and cardiac problems. Poor performers exhibited lower speeds at blood lactate concentration of 4 mmol/l (VLA4) and at heart rates of 160 (V160) and 200 bpm (V200) on the treadmill and in the field, as well as slower recovery of heart rate.

Allergic diseases occur in most mammals, although some species such as humans, dogs and horses seem to be more prone to develop allergies than others. In horses, insect bite hypersensitivity (IBH), an allergic dermatitis caused by bites of midges, and recurrent airway obstruction (RAO), a hyperreactivity to stable born dust and allergens, are the two most prevalent allergic diseases. Allergic diseases involve the interaction of three major factors: (i) genetic constitution, (ii) exposure to allergens, and (iii) a dysregulation of the immune response determined by (i) and (ii). However, other environmental factors such as infectious diseases, contact with endotoxin and degree of infestation with endoparasites have been shown to influence the prevalence of allergic diseases in humans. How these factors may impact upon allergic disease in the horse is unknown at this time. The 3rd workshop on Allergic Diseases of the Horse, with major sponsorship from the Havemeyer Foundation, was held in Hólar, Iceland, in June 2007 and focussed on immunological and genetic aspects of IBH and RAO. This particular venue was chosen because of the prevalence of IBH in exported Icelandic horses. The incidence of IBH is significantly different between Icelandic horses born in Europe or North America and those born in Iceland and exported as adults. Although the genetic factors and allergens are the same, exported adult horses show a greater incidence of IBH. This suggests that environmental or epigenetic factors may contribute to this response. This report summarizes the present state of knowledge and summarizes important issues discussed at the workshop.
